def test_ftp_server_init_default():
    dut = ftp.Server(name='pytest')
    assert dut.events == ftp.Server.ALL_EVENTS
    assert dut.port == 2121
    assert dut.user is None
    assert dut.max_cons == 256
    assert dut.max_cons_ip == 5

def test_ftp_server_init_user_pwd():
    dut = ftp.Server(name='pytest', user_pwd=None)
    assert dut.user is None
    assert not hasattr(dut, 'password')

    dut = ftp.Server(name='pytest', user_pwd='admin')
    assert dut.user == 'admin'
    assert dut.password == ''

    dut = ftp.Server(name='pytest', user_pwd=('admin', 'root'))
    assert dut.user == 'admin'
    assert dut.password == 'root'

    with pytest.raises(TypeError) as err:
        ftp.Server(name='pytest', user_pwd=5)
    assert "TypeError: Argument 'user_pwd' is expected to be a str (user) or a tuple of user and password." in str(
        err)
